吞吐量是衡量系统性能的重要指标之一,通常用于描述系统在单位时间内处理请求的能力。在计算机科学中,吞吐量的度量单位通常是请求数/秒。
请求数/秒是衡量系统处理能力的标准,它表示系统在每秒钟内可以处理的请求数量。这个指标可以帮助我们了解系统的性能和效率,以及系统在不同负载下的表现。
对于Web服务器、数据库服务器等系统,吞吐量是非常重要的指标。在Web服务器中,吞吐量通常指的是服务器在单位时间内可以处理的HTTP请求数量。在数据库服务器中,吞吐量则指的是服务器在单位时间内可以处理的查询、插入、更新等操作的数量。
为了提高系统的吞吐量,我们需要采取一些优化措施。例如,可以通过优化算法、减少系统资源消耗、提高硬件性能等方式来提高系统的处理能力。此外,还可以通过负载均衡、并行处理等技术来提高系统的吞吐量。
影响吞吐量的因素:
1、硬件资源:硬件资源是影响系统吞吐量的基础因素。如果服务器或计算机的硬件配置较低,那么其处理能力就会受到限制,从而影响吞吐量。因此,为了提高系统的吞吐量,需要确保硬件资源充足且性能良好。
2、网络带宽:网络带宽也是影响系统吞吐量的重要因素。如果网络带宽不足,那么系统在处理请求时就会受到限制,导致吞吐量下降。因此,需要确保网络带宽充足且稳定,以保证系统的高吞吐量。
3、并发请求数:并发请求数是影响系统吞吐量的另一个重要因素。如果并发请求数过多,那么系统在处理这些请求时就会面临压力,导致吞吐量下降。因此,需要合理控制并发请求数,避免系统过载。
4、负载均衡:负载均衡也是影响系统吞吐量的因素之一。如果负载均衡不当,那么系统在处理请求时就会不均衡,导致部分请求处理速度较慢,从而影响整体吞吐量。因此,需要合理配置负载均衡策略,确保系统负载均衡且高效。